Ameloblastoma is a slow-growing, persistent, and locally aggressive neoplasm arising from the odontogenic epithelium. Only 10 percent of ameloblastomas occur in the anterior mandible. We present a case of an anterior mandibular ameloblastoma that was previously histpathologically diagnosed as a dentigerous cyst. Patient underwent wide surgical excision of the tumor followed by immediate reconstruction using non vascularized autogenous graft from the anterior ileum, stabilized with titanium reconstructive plates. A brief case report and review of literature is presented.
